About This Item

New York: National Lampoon, 1973. First Edition. Hardcover. Very Good/Near Fine. 4to. 152pp. Illus, Cover Art By Wrightson and Frazetta. Hardcover. First Editon. Very Good. (Missing front flyleaf).Near Fine jacket. Slight rubbing to front panel of dj. This is not the bookclub edition price on dw 7.95 Map at the rear.A scarce item in hardcover.
